Year 1, Term 3, Week 2: Ideas for Senior Group

Week 2: God Loves His People - And He is Powerful!

 

Lesson Objective:

God is powerful - he showed Moses that he was powerful enough to rescue His people from Egypt!

 

Bible Passage:

Exodus 4:1-11 (Moses Miracles)

 

Memory Verse:

Exodus 4:12- "Now Go! When you speak, I will be with you and give you the words to say."

Story Idea: Team Trust Challenge & Read It!

 

Before the lesson:

- Create an obstacle course (chairs to go over/under, obstacles to weave around, play tunnel to crawl through etc.)

 

To introduce:

- Ask the kids if they can remember last weeks lesson, and prompt them to remember that God asked Moses to go and rescue His people!

- Have the kids form a snake (holding hands)

- The whole team must complete the obstacle course without breaking the snake chain - each team member must be touching the next in line the whole time!

- To make it harder, try blindfolding everybody but the leader and completing the challenge again!

- For an EXTRA HARD challenge, blindfold the kids, then move some obstacles so they are disorientated!

 

Discuss:

- Do you need the help of your team mates to make the challenge work? (Yes)

- If you are blindfolded, how do you know you can trust your team members to help you through? (You know them well, you know they can do obstacle courses and have seen them complete the course before)

 

Have the kids read Exodus 4:1-12, taking turns to read a verse or two each

Quiz Questions: 

​

1. What was Moses worried might happen when he told everyone that God had spoken to him? Nobody would listen

2. What is a miracle? Something amazing that God does that we can't explain

3. What miracles did God do in the story? Turned the stick into the snake, turned his hand white, turned water into blood

4. What do you think these miracles tell us about God? He is POWERFUL

5. How would seeing these miracles help Moses to trust God? He could better understand how powerful God is

6. How might they help other people to believe that God really did speak to Moses if Moses showed them God's miracles too? They would be amazed and know that only God could help Moses do the miracles

7. What else was Moses worried about? That he wouldn't know what to say

8. What promises did God make to Moses? I will be with you and give you the words to say

9. Can we trust God to help us too? Yes

10. How do we know we can trust God?  He is powerful, He has promised to be with us in the Bible, He has shown that He can be trusted over and over again in the Bible, in our lives and in the lives of those we know (just like we knew we could trust our friends based on seeing them be trustworthy before)

11. What could you do if you are scared, nervous or having trouble trusting God? Pray - tell God how you feel and ask Him to help you, read the Bible to see how God has shown Himself to be trustworthy, talk to other Christians - ask them for stories of how God has helped them

Craft Idea: Accordion Snake!

original (5).jpg

Before the lesson:

- Download and print the lesson reminder circle on coloured paper, cut out, punch a hole through the top and tie a length of string to it

- Gather coloured paper, googley eyes, scissors, pens and glue

- Cut a series of coloured paper strips, round shapes for the head and tongue shapes from red paper

 

Have the kids:

- Fold twisty accordion shapes by holding the ends of two strips of paper together, perpendicular to each other, then alternately folding one strip over another until the accordion is formed. Eager kids can make several accordions and glue them together to make a long snake!

- Glue a snake face on the front, googley eyes and a tongue

- Punch a hole in the back of the tail and tie in the lesson reminder
